Facts About Database Optimization Revealed

Data Redundancy: Keep away from storing exactly the same data in many areas. Normalize your tables and use overseas keys to generate associations.

Require Stakeholders: Get input from distinct departments or people who will be working with the info. 

After you have a transparent comprehension of your details, it’s the perfect time to translate that expertise into SQL commands to generate the tables inside your database. Below’s a breakdown of the procedure:

Uniqueness: The key vital benefit have to be exceptional For each and every row within the desk. No two rows can provide the identical Most important critical value.

A database occasion, Alternatively, is often a snapshot of a database because it existed at a certain time. So, database situations can alter after some time, Whilst a database schema is generally static, since it’s challenging to alter the framework of the database at the time it is operational.

In place of indicating, "what is that funny rap music from your Sonic the Hedgehog 2 movie?" you would possibly type in "Sonic the Hedgehog two soundtrack list." This formatting change causes it to be less difficult with the algorithm to pull the information you may need immediately.

The initial standard kind (abbreviated as 1NF) specifies that each mobile inside the desk can have only one value, hardly ever an index of values, so a table like this does not comply:

Inflexible Design: Don’t foresee each individual future have to have, but design with some volume of versatility to accommodate potential advancement and variations.

Past Bachelors's and Masters's Levels, you may have to search for candidates with additional certifications connected with database systems.

Utilizing techniques which include combination functions, subqueries, buying and grouping to retrieve knowledge from a table

Small-code development platforms are driving the expanding acceptance of database development. Advanced database units can be built much more quickly and easily owing to these platforms, which permit builders to make apps with small to no coding.

Designing an efficient, handy database is really a issue of adhering to the proper method, read more which include these phases:

Performance: Evaluate the performance within your database under various load conditions. This helps pinpoint spots for optimization and makes sure the procedure can tackle serious-earth utilization.

In the actual entire world, entities seldom exist in isolation. They often have connections with each other. Your facts model really should replicate these associations to precisely symbolize the information structure.

Leave a Reply

Your email address will not be published. Required fields are marked *